Marcos Mamay (born Marcos Maguindanao Mamay; June 15, 1979), is a Filipino politician and economist who is currently serving as the municipal mayor of Nunungan. Mamay was first elected as mayor in 2016, and was re-elected in 2019 and 2022.

'Mamay: The Great Man of Nunungan'[edit]

A reenactment of the struggles and achievements of Mayor Marcos Mamay will be featured in a biographical film to inspire people that poverty is not a hindrance to success. The film dubbed “Mamay: The Great Man of Nunungan” showcases how the mayor survived his early life from striving hard to graduate from school with challenges such as rido or family feud to selling ukay-ukay and becoming a great public servant.[1][2][3]
